  I would switch the X and Y inputs between the game PCB and the monitor to see if the collapse changes to the other axis... if so, then the issue is on the game PCB (unlikely). If the collapse is on the same axis, the issue is on the monitor.

  A transistor may be open (and most likely is if you aren't blowing fuses) so it won't show a short if that was what you were looking for with the meter. Pull the deflection PCB, make sure all the molex connectors have goos solder joints, I would suck and re-solder all of them anyway as they all have problems eventually. See if you still have an issue... if so, report back. :-)

    Folks I'm making progress on bringing a dead WG 6100 back to life, but am stuck. The right half of the screen is collapsed into a vertical line. The left half is fine. I checked all of the chassis mount and deflection board transistors with a multimeter and they seem fine. Any pointers would be appreciated.
